BSJN was delisted on the 15th of December, 2023.
140 hedge funds and large institutions have $465M invested in Invesco BulletShares 2023 High Yield Corporate Bond ETF in 2021 Q4 according to their latest regulatory filings, with 31 funds opening new positions, 56 increasing their positions, 29 reducing their positions, and 9 closing their positions.
